When Jesus cast a legion of demons from a man, he demonstrated His authority over evil and His ability to give new life. The demons acknowledged Jesus' as Lord, but hated Him. The locals begged Jesus to leave. The disciples, who witnessed the event, might have looked on the scene with fear and amazement. As we consider Luke's account of this miracle, we should also be awed by the saving power of Jesus and the immense value that the Savior places on every soul held captive to sin.
